Accommodation

Over two floors.Three bedrooms: 1 x king-size, 1 x double, 1 x single.

Bathroom with roll-top bath, separate walk-in shower, basin, heated towel rail and WC.

Kitchen/diner.

Living/dining room.

Gas central heating (please note the lounge gas fire is no longer in use).

Electric oven and hob, microwave, fridge, fridge/freezer, washer/dryer, dishwasher.

43 inch Smart TV, WiFi, a selection of books and games.

Fuel and power included in rent.

Bed linen and towels included in rent.

Enclosed garden suitable for most dogs with a patio featuring outdoor seating and gravel area.

Perfectly located for people with a variety of interests as centrally located for shopping, historical sites, theatres and sports.

Canal around the corner, for walks into town and cycling and The Bandstand is a short walk away with summer entertainment and buskers.

Cycling available on the Stratford Greenway route which is a sustrans national route.

Stratford Leisure Centre is less than a mile away with children's climbing, swimming pool, gym and indoor football.

Railway station under a mile, so you can have a drive free holiday.

Shakespeare's birthplace is only a 10 minute walk and The Royal Shakespeare Theatre is a 15 minute walk away.

Butterfly Farm less than a mile away.

Golf course and Lido approx 2 miles away.

Angling available at Recreation Park and The Lido.

Please note some attractions/activities may be seasonal.

Fantastic access to the wider Cotswold region for day trips eg Bourton on the Water, Bibury Trout Farm or to Cheltenham for a day at The Races.

Roadside permit parking for one car, please leave the permit in the property on check out for the next guests.

Golf, cycling,walking guests all welcome.

Welcome basket includes a box of chocolates, box of cookies, tea, coffee, sugar, milk and hot chocolate.

Pet bookings also have a dog bed, dog bowl and dog treats.

One well-behaved pet welcome.

Sorry, no smoking.

Shop 0.4 miles, pub 0.3 miles.

  • Keith

    The bed in the main room was comfortable, but in the second room was quite hard for our tastes. There was a good shower. We did have a lovely stay but there were several downsides that could very easily be remedied to make it even better. To my mind it could be so much nicer if it were furnished and finished to a higher standard. The lounge chairs are very uncomfortable and the dining table and chairs are not matching and feel very rickety. It needs nets and curtains everywhere to make it feel more private and cosy. There was only a small hanging rack in each bedroom, with no dressing table and nowhere in the bathroom to put toiletries and make-up. Only the mirror in the single bedroom was next to a socket for the hairdryer. There was no mention in the description that there is a cellar, or that there are changes of level on both the ground and first floors, which for me made it harder to get around. The fridge-freezer is very oddly positioned under the stairs at the top of the flight down to the cellar, surrounding by cleaning equipment, and with the doors opening the 'wrong' way so it was hard to access. The property says it is dog-friendly but I think they were only expecting a small dog as the bed and bowls left were tiny and our Labrador could easily have escaped from the garden if we had let her off the lead. In addition, the property was not as clean as I would like and we had to do a lot ourselves. The kitchen tap dripped constantly. I also would have liked more than one parking permit as we had to juggle cars in and out of other parking places that were expensive and/or restrictive on hours.
